Transaction 86d704a38ba362e259ae1e41633499ba8d29fed70c2d913b83edd80746e47bb3
1 Input
1 Output
-
86d704a38ba362e259ae1e41633499ba8d29fed70c2d913b83edd80746e47bb3:0
- value
- 1120994795
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dbe2f5cbe6218ddbfb884410f5c74f3c63fbd2eb OP_EQUAL
- address
- 3Mjfo2DW2dNztaWwr8942y9iJUgE7sPoGW